Target Company Information
Electriq Power, founded in 2014 in Silicon Valley, specializes in intelligent energy storage and management solutions tailored for residential and small business applications. The company effectively combines its technologies with rooftop solar systems, delivering consistent access to low-cost clean energy, even during power outages or adverse weather conditions. Electriq operates under an innovative go-to-market strategy that aims to make solar and storage solutions accessible to diverse socio-economic groups across the United States, including low- and middle-income communities. Its community engagements span locations from Santa Barbara and Parlier in California to Washington, D.C., and Puerto Rico. Electriq's operational scope is further enhanced by extensive partnerships with key industry players, including a global manufacturer and growing providers of microgrids.
Industry Overview in the U.S.
The U.S. residential solar energy and storage market is experiencing significant growth driven by a shift toward sustainable energy solutions. Solar installations are projected to expand at an annual rate of 17%, bolstered by recent federal initiatives such as the Inflation Reduction Act, which provides rebates, tax credits, and other incentives. These measures are anticipated to enhance market conditions and accelerate investment in solar technology and infrastructure.
Furthermore, there is a marked increase in the adoption of energy storage systems alongside rooftop solar installations. The rate of attachment is expected to grow dramatically, from a mere 2% in 2017 to nearly 30% by 2025. This pairing offers several advantages, including reduced energy costs, reliable energy access during outages, and decreased reliance on fossil fuels.
Additionally, a burgeoning awareness among consumers about the benefits of solar energy coupled with government support for green initiatives contributes to the rapid evolution of the residential solar market. With technology development and innovation continuing to advance, the sector is on the brink of transformative changes that promise to enhance efficiency and sustainability.

Rationale Behind the Deal
The merger between Electriq Power and TLG Acquisition One Corp. represents a strategic alignment aimed at leveraging the growing demand for residential solar energy storage solutions. Mike Lawrie, CEO of TLGA, emphasized that this merger is perfectly timed to address the significant opportunities presented by the expanding market, heightened technological advancements, and supportive government policies. By merging, both companies aim to create new value and opportunities for their stakeholders.
Frank Magnotti, CEO of Electriq, expressed the readiness of their team to embark on the next phase of growth following the milestones they've achieved in technology and customer engagement. The synergies expected from this merger should provide a solid foundation for expanding Electriq's market presence and enhancing their product offerings.
Investor Information
TLG Acquisition One Corp. is a publicly traded special purpose acquisition company (SPAC) that seeks to invest in promising companies to drive value creation. The planned merger indicates TLGA's commitment to participating in the sustainable energy sector, reflecting a strategic investment approach that capitalizes on market growth opportunities. The transaction is expected to provide Electriq with up to $125 million in capital to support its growth agenda through a structure of debt and equity financing.
Electriq is also in advanced discussions to secure an additional $60 million in capital from various sources, including a leading institutional investor and convertible debt commitments. This capital is crucial as it will facilitate Electriq's ambitious expansion plans in the rapidly evolving energy landscape.
